TI: On the Statistics of the Seasonal Geomagnetic Variations.

AB: We analyze the data sets of daily average Dst (1957-2005) and Ap (1932-2005) indices. Differential and integral statistical distribution functions of geomagnetic perturbations versus their strength constructed. First moments of the distributions calculated. Asymptotic behavior of the distributions at extremely low and high magnetic activity as well as around mean and most probable states obtained for the whole data sets and for the selected periods of time (spring and autumn, summer and winter) around equinoxes and solstices. We confirm and extend the results of some previous studies. Absolute and relative amplitudes of seasonal geomagnetic variations interpreted as a consequence of the non-linear magnetospheric response to the solar and heliospheric drivers.
